Output 84ae91ab4a19947ee41541a5a666cb5aabca58ca89fc04162c20b0e56cce6f19:49

value
10089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f738e7471202b15c3be1c69f50c7926248b6695 OP_EQUAL
address
3APiYmhi5dDNF5cjDXS2xmYMt47U3LLxRc
transaction
84ae91ab4a19947ee41541a5a666cb5aabca58ca89fc04162c20b0e56cce6f19
confirmations
169151
spent
true